New simplified procedures for the funerals of popes were released earlier this month, reflecting Pope Francis’ ongoing effort to emphasize the pope’s role as a pastor.
After witnessing the funeral service for his predecessor, Emeritus Pope Benedict XVI, in 2023, Francis asked the Vatican’s master of ceremonies, Monsignor Diego Ravelli, to review the papal funeral rites. The new rules were approved in April, and Francis was given a copy of the book on Nov. 4.
